===Origin/meaning=== | |||
The arms were officially granted on June 18, 1619 and again on June 14, 1974. | The arms were officially granted on June 18, 1619 and again on June 14, 1974. | ||
The arms show St. Hermagoras, the local patron saint. He is also the patron saint of the church in Aquileia, the town historically belonged to the Patriarchate of Aquileia. | The arms show St. Hermagoras, the local patron saint.
